self-released Seattle's Midnight Idols are under the impression that the early 80's never ended and I find absolutely nothing wrong with that. In a sea of endless complex prog, brutal tech death and keyboard overdosed goth metal, its refreshing to hear a band that likes to stick to the basics. Midnight Idols will never claim to be the most original band out there, but as long as they're having fun, does it really matter? With a raw production that mirrors that of the early 80's, the band blazes through 10 songs that are equal parts Scorpions, DiAnno era Maiden, Thin Lizzy and every other NWOBHM band you can shake a stick at. There is no real need to describe each individual song, if you're a fan of the above mentioned bands you'll be headbanging and air guitaring in no time flat. Album highlight would probably be Nihilistic Angel, which could have easily been a single by any of those notable NWOBHM bands back then. Just take my word for it, We Rule The Night, umm, rules. 01.
